- the present invention relates to a screw cap consisting of a spout with an external thread and at least one retaining element and a screw cap with a shell wall with internal thread, which meshes with the external thread of the spout and aligned over predetermined breaking points, arranged under the jacket wall of the screw cap guarantee strip, which with the at least one retaining element on the spout cooperates.
- Screw caps with a guarantee band have been known for many years.
- the guarantee band should be recognizable that the contents of a container, which is closed with the corresponding screw cap, is intact. Accordingly, it is often spoken of an opening guarantee. Screw caps of this type have been known for many years. Just as long, however, the problem is known that these guarantee bands already during demoulding from the injection mold or in the subsequent
- the guarantee strip has an annular holding bead which engages behind a corresponding holding bead or an annular groove on the spout part.
- the screw cap is aligned with the guarantee band over the spout, and then axially moved downward, wherein the internal thread of the screw cap on the external thread of the spout slides over each other in a ratchet-like manner.
- the guarantee strip is widened by the thickness of the retaining bead, with relatively high forces are required.
- the predetermined breaking point bridges are on the one hand compressed and on the other hand displaced radially outward by the expansion. Here it often happens that part of the predetermined breaking point bridges is destroyed. Accordingly, this must be monitored to remove reject production from the line.
- Predetermined breaking point bridges conditionally. Accordingly, predetermined breaking point bridges have already been destroyed during assembly here.
- a screw cap of the type mentioned in that three to five radially outwardly directed retaining elements in the form of Posts are arranged, which at least in the twisting direction to the installation coming retaining surfaces which cooperate with arranged on the guarantee strip abutment surfaces, wherein the guarantee strip, in which abutment surfaces adjacent area each has a cross section of the guarantee strip reducing bending zone, and further that the predetermined breaking bridges as far as The bending zones are arranged away that here no relative displacement occurs during the deformation of the guarantee strip.

- the inventive screw cap which is generally designated 1, consists of two separately manufactured parts which are shown here in the assembled state. This is on the one hand the spout or spout 2 and on the other the screw cap 3, which is connected to a guarantee strip 4.
- the spout or spout is shown here as a separate part with a terminal flange 22, as it is for example applied to a liquid packaging made of a multilayer film produced packaging or on a tubular bag of pure Plastic film can be welded.
- the spout or spout 2 may also be part of a plastic bottle, the spout practically corresponds to the bottleneck.
- the spout 2 consists of a cylindrical tube section 20 which is provided with an external thread 21.
- this cylindrical pipe section of the terminal flange 22 is formed.
- This flange is used for adhesive bonding or welding connection with the appropriate container.
- a circumferential collar 23 is formed at this circumferential collar.
- radially outwardly projecting retaining elements 24 are formed, which here have the form of posts.
- the screw cap 1 is equipped with four such retaining elements or posts 24. The number of these posts 24 is preferably chosen between 3 and 5.
- the guarantee strip may change too large in shape during assembly, so that the security that the predetermined breaking bridges will no longer be damaged during In the case of a number of bridges over 5, the deformability of the guarantee strip is too severely restricted and, in turn, there is likewise the risk that the predetermined breaking point bridges break during assembly.
- FIG. 3 the guarantee strip according to the invention is shown in FIG. 3a once from the outside and in FIG. 3b from the inside, both times in unwinding.
- the guarantee strip 4 is connected to the screw cap 3 only via the predetermined breaking point bridges 40.
- the guarantee strip itself has sections of different heights.
- the upper edge 42 extends at three different heights.
- the sections with the lowest height form the so-called bending zones 43.
- the areas with the greatest height form the support zones 44.
- the sections 45 are zones in which the predetermined breaking point bridges 40 are arranged.
- radially inwardly directed walls 46 which are designed as abutment surfaces and between those in the guarantee position before the first opening the posts or retaining elements 24th lie. These walls 46 serve as abutment surfaces for the posts and are mainly provided because the guarantee strip is made extremely thin.
- the wall of the guarantee strip 4 is made thicker except in the bending zones 43, these radially inwardly directed walls 46 are unnecessary. However, these optionally inwardly directed walls 46 are advantageous because the corresponding posts 24 can be made correspondingly shorter and thus do not have to protrude outside the contour of the guarantee strip 4. This can be seen most clearly in the figure 5. In this figure, it is also seen that the outer end face 47 of the posts 24 on the one hand from the inside to the outside and from top to bottom inclined or curved. This design is therefore chosen so that when placing the screw cap 3, in which the internal thread of the screw cap and the external thread of the spout are ratchet-like pushed over each other, the guarantee strip 4 does not hit the post.
- the height of the wall of the guarantee strip is designed differently high in the guide shape shown here, and so the various zones are formed. But it is also quite possible in addition to these differences in height to make the guarantee strip 4 so that the strip thickness in the region of the bending zone 43 is substantially thinner than in the other zones.
- FIG. This illustration shows the guarantee strip 4 in its maximum deformation during placement of the screw cap on the spout 2.
- the guarantee strip 4 if four posts are present as shown here, approximately square deformed.
- the spout 2 can form the bottleneck of a plastic bottle and in this case the posts 24 are formed on this bottleneck.
- the spout 2 is provided with a flange 22 for welding or gluing with a flexible container and in this case, the aforementioned posts 24 are formed on this spout or spout, as is particularly clear from the Figure 5 can be seen.

Abstract
Dans les fermetures à vis (1) constituées d'un goulot verseur (2) sur lequel est posée une capsule à vis (3) munie d'une bande d'inviolabilité (4), des ponts à points de rupture (40) formés entre la bande d'inviolabilité (4) et la capsule à vis (3) sont exposés à un risque de destruction prématurée lors du démoulage hors du moule à injection ou lors de la pose axiale sur le goulot verseur. Selon l'invention, des tenons (24) faisant office d'éléments de retenue sont agencés sur le goulot verseur (2). Ils s'engagent dans la bande d'inviolabilité (4) avant la première ouverture. La bande d'inviolabilité (4) comporte pour sa part des zones de flexion affaiblies (43) dans des parties qui sont poussées vers l'extérieur par les tenons lors de la pose axiale. Les ponts à points de rupture (40) sont agencés aux endroits où la bande d'inviolabilité (4) croise le bord inférieur de la capsule à vis (3) pendant la pose et lors de la déformation maximale de la bande d'inviolabilité (4). La bande d'inviolabilité peut présenter, outre les zones de flexion affaiblies (43), des zones d'appui plus hautes (44), tandis que les sections (45) se trouvant entre lesdites zones présentent une hauteur moyenne.
